The Machine Operator has a primary responsibility to run and maintain machine and other related equipment. (S)he operates continuous flow equipment to process milk, cream, and other beverage products, following specified methods and formulas. (S)he is responsible for quality, food safety and product specifications.

Essential Duties:

  • Clean, set-up, operate and monitor equipment of the production line.
  • Operates ingredients distribution feeder.
  • Complete all required documentation and scheduled quality checks.
  • Monitor weights, seals, caps, and general packaging of product.
  • Make adjustments to filler timing and filling, & check mat as needed.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ve basic to moderate operating difficulties.
  • Collect required samples needed for Quality Assurance testing.
  • Ensure that the proper packaging materials are used for each product being produced.
  • Perform filler and filler line changeovers in a safe and efficient manner.
  • Complete cleaning checklist once line has completed run.
  • Prepare equipment for next run to include size changes as needed.
  • Maintain communication with other departments, management and employees and notify them of any problems and/or concerns that may restrict the efficiency of production.
  • Ensure all paperwork is filled out in a clear, legible and accurate format, and completed with required information.
  • Ensure all required information is documented in accordance with SOP's.
  • Analyze process data and equipment performance data to improve quality, throughput, and troubleshoot.
  • Utilizing continuous improvement mindset, assist in identifying opportunities to improve processes.
  • Follow Good Manufacturing Practices.
  • Maintain a clean, sanitary and safe work area.
  • Follow all required work safe practices.
  • Responsible for food safety, pre-requisite programs and food quality related to designated area.
  • Report any food safety and food quality related issues to management immediately.
  • Other duties as assigned.
